1.Design and application of an extracorporeal membrane oxygenation dressing
Lu ZHOU ; Yan YUE ; Shuhan TU ; Min DENG ; Qiulian SONG
Chinese Journal of Integrated Traditional and Western Medicine in Intensive and Critical Care 2024;31(3):361-363
		                        		
		                        			
		                        			Extracorporeal membrane oxygenation(ECMO),an effective extracorporeal circulation support system,holds significant importance in the treatment of severe cardiovascular and pulmonary diseases.Effective fixation of ECMO catheters can prevent adverse events such as displacement and accidental extubation,thereby ensuring the effectiveness and continuity of ECMO treatment.At present,various tools such as transparent dressings,surgical dressings,and bandages are commonly used in clinical practice.However,there are problems such as insufficient fixation,unattractive and tidy appearance,and inconvenient replacement.There is still a lack of specific and effective dressings to fix ECMO catheters.Therefore,the medical staff from department of critical care medical of Hospital of Chengdu University of Traditional Chinese Medicine designed ECMO dressing,and obtained the National Utility Model Patent of China(patent number:ZL 202120543021.3),which includes 3 parts:upper dressing,middle dressing,and lower dressing with weak connections in sequence.The top surface of the upper dressing is the upper dressing layer,which is marked with a first scale.The middle part of the bottom surface of the upper dressing layer is fixed with a gauze layer.The top surface of the middle dressing is the middle dressing layer,and the bottom surface of the middle dressing layer is fixedly equipped with a mesh layer along the edges of the 2 length directions.There is a cutting gauze between the 2 mesh layers,and the 2 length edges of the cutting gauze are fixedly connected to the mesh layer.There is a plastic film between the cutting gauze and the middle dressing layer,and cracks are evenly spaced along the length direction of the cutting gauze.The top surface of the middle dressing layer is marked with a second scale.There is an opening at the connection between the lower dressing and the middle dressing,and the bottom surface of the lower dressing is an adhesive layer.This utility model,simple design,good fixing effect,convenient replacement,can avoid catheter slippage and displacement,reduce the occurrence of pressure-related injuries to instruments,and improve the quality of clinical work.It is worth promoting and applying in clinical practice.
		                        		
		                        		
		                        		
		                        	
2.Arts syndrome: a case report and literature review
Lulu ZHOU ; Qiulian XIANG ; Hu GUO
Chinese Journal of Applied Clinical Pediatrics 2021;36(21):1651-1653
		                        		
		                        			
		                        			Objective:To investigate the clinical and genetic features of children with Arts syndrome.Methods:The clinical features of a child with Arts syndrome diagnosed in Department of Neurology, Children′s Hospital of Nanjing Medical University were retrospectively analyzed.Relevant literatures about Arts syndromes were reviewed as well.Results:It was a 17-month-old boy with initial symptoms of hearing loss after birth, delayed motor development and early-onset hypotonia.At the age of 15 months old, the boy had respiratory failure due to pneumonia.Electromyographic suggested multiple peripheral neurogenic lesions.Visual evoked potentials were normal.Gene sequencing of PRPS1 of the boy revealed a novel hemizygous missense c. 421C>T (p.P141S) hemizygote missense mutation, and therefore, the boy was diagnosed as Arts syndrome.Motor development improved after rehabilitation treatment.Through literature review, 14 children with Arts syndrome, including 4 genotypes of missense mutations were reviewed in 4 English-published literatures.These cases had similar manifestations with the case reported in this study.Conclusions:Arts syndrome is a rare X-linked recessive inheritant disorder caused by PRPS1 mutations with complex clinical phenotypes.The novel missense mutation c. 421C>T found in this study expands the PRPS1 gene mutation profile.
		                        		
		                        		
		                        		
		                        	
3.A de novel mutation of the HSD17B4-related peroxisome D-bifunctional protein deficiency in a family and literature review
Qiulian XIANG ; Hu GUO ; Xiucheng GAO ; Lulu ZHOU ; Jianmin SONG ; Xiaopeng LU
Chinese Journal of Applied Clinical Pediatrics 2021;36(10):772-775
		                        		
		                        			
		                        			Objective:To investigate the clinical and genetic characteristics of peroxisome D-bifunctional protein deficiency (PDBPD) associated with HSD17B4 mutation. Methods:The clinical and genetic characteristics of 2 cases of PDBPD in August 2020, at Children′s Hospital Affiliated to Nanjing Medical University caused by HSD17B4 gene mutation were retrospectively analyzed. Results:Male proband and his sister suffered from neonatal epilepsy, psychomotor development disorders, ataxia, myasthenia, hearing impairment, and foot deformity.The very long chain fatty acids in serum were normal, and brain magnetic resonance imaging (MRI) showed bilateral cerebellar hemisphere atrophy.Electromyography suggested changes in the myoelectricity of multiple peripheral neurogenic lesions.Auditory evoked potential displayed severe bilateral sensorineural hearing loss.Exome sequencing identified compound heterozygous mutations (c.1171G > C, c.686-2A>T) in HSD17B4.The clinical diagnosis was PDBPD, aged 8 and 14 years, respectively. Conclusions:Two cases of HSD17B4 mutation-induced PDBPD were first reported in Chinese mainland, which was in line with its typical clinical manifestations.The newly discovered c. 1171G> C and c. 686-2A>T mutations enriched the HSD17B4 mutation spectrum.
		                        		
		                        		
		                        		
		                        	
4.Development and evaluation of loop-mediated isothermal amplification assay for the rapid detection of Escherichia coli and its microbial toxin
Yukui ZHONG ; Lisi DENG ; Qiulian DENG ; Huamin ZHONG ; Mingyong LUO ; Zhenwen ZHOU ; Muxia YAN ; Yongqiang XIE
Journal of Chinese Physician 2018;20(6):826-831
		                        		
		                        			
		                        			Objective To establish and optimize a loop-mediated isothermal amplification (LAMP) method for the rapid detection of Escherichia coli and its microbial toxin.Methods The LAMP reaction system and reaction conditions were determined by optimizing LAMP reaction,and the optimized LAMP system was used for the detection.Results Primers targeting shiga toxin (stx) gene and O157 antigen gene rfbe were designed.The established and optimized LAMP amplification system contained 1.2 mmol/L dNTPs,10 mmol/L MgSO4,0.4 mol/L betaine,1 μl 10 × Bst DNA polymerase Buffer,8 U Bst DNA polymerase fragment,2 μl DNA template,and the ratio of inner-primer (FIP and BIP) and outerprimer (F3 and B3) were 8∶ 1.Time and temperature for LAMP was 60 min,60 ℃.The sensitivity was 103 times higher than polymerase chain reaction (PCR),reached 5 × 101 CFU/ml.When LAMP was applied to 19 reference strains,102 EHEC strains,the specification was 100% while identification rate of rfbe,stx1 and stx2 gene reached 100%,95.2%,92.9%.Conclusions The LAMP method showed a promising prospect for the rapid detection of common nosocomial pathogens microbial toxin.
		                        		
		                        		
		                        		
		                        	
5.The Thought about Establishment of Standardized Ethical Review Mechanism for Clinical Trials
Chinese Medical Ethics 2018;31(6):726-728,735
		                        		
		                        			
		                        			The establishment of standardized ethical review mechanism for clinical trials is an objective requirement for improving the ethical review of clinical trials and ensuring the safety and smoothness of various clinical trials. According to the practice of years engaged in the ethical review of clinical trials, this paper proposed to start from six aspects, that is, to establish a scientific and reasonable ethics committee; establish a special ethics office;establish a scientific and reasonable ethical review standard;grasp the emphasis of the ethical review;attach importance to the continuing review;strictly observe the principles of ethical review, and then establish a standardized ethical review mechanism for clinical trials.
		                        		
		                        		
		                        		
		                        	
6.Clinical analysis of 2 siblings with late-onset meningitis caused by group B streptococcus which were homogenous to the colonization bacteria of their mother
Shan OUYANG ; Kankan GAO ; Haiying LIU ; Qiulian DENG ; Lanlan ZENG ; Sufei ZHU ; Ping WANG ; Ning ZHAO ; Yueju CAI ; Wei ZHOU
Chinese Journal of Applied Clinical Pediatrics 2018;33(10):783-786
		                        		
		                        			
		                        			Objective To raise awareness of the late-onset meningitis caused by group B streptococcus (GBS) which was homogenous to the maternal colonization.Methods The clinical data of late-onset GBS meningitis in neonates twins whose pathogens were homogenous to their maternal colonization were collected from Department of Neonatology,Guangzhou Women and Children's Medical Center.The general conditions,clinical symptoms,laboratory tests and drug treatment of the twins and their mother were retrospectively analyzed,and the GBS homology during inpatient care was tested.And the progress of the twins' condition was investigated by telephone follow-up.Results The mother had two pregnancies without prenatal GBS screening or intrapartum antimicrobial intervention for GBS,everything was normal during pregnancy and delivery.Twins were born through cesarean section.The elder sister was discharged with Linezolid taken orally after 167 days in hospital without convulsions,shaking or other discomfort.The elder sister was followed up for every 2 weeks,and in the last time of follow-up,cerebrospinal fluid white blood cell counts were 45 × 106/L,protein level was 1.52 g/L and Linezolid was withdrawn.The younger brother was discharged after 58 days in hospital with follow-up for every 2 weeks,and in the last time of follow-up,cerebrospinal fluid white blood cell counts were 30 × 106/L,protein level was 0.66 g/L.During the hospitalization and follow-up without convulsions and irritation,and the cranial magnetic resonance imaging of the twin brother was normal.Test results showed that the GBS bacteria strain for twins and their mother were all serotype Ⅲ.The possibility of the GBS homology was more than 90%.Conclusions The toxicity of serotype Ⅲ GBS strain was strong.More proactive precautions should be considered to apply for the mother whose first birth already had GBS infection.Early identification and intervention of infection risk factors would help optimize the anti-infection treatment program and reduce nerve system damage and other adverse outcomes caused by invasive GBS infection.
		                        		
		                        		
		                        		
		                        	
7.Structural equation modeling analysis of the quality of life′s influencing factors among puerperal women
Hui ZHU ; Yujuan FENG ; Shuxian ZENG ; Qiulian ZHONG ; Jing PU ; Jinyun YU ; Yamin ZHOU ; Li LIAO
Chinese Journal of Practical Nursing 2017;33(15):1135-1138
		                        		
		                        			
		                        			Objective To explore the relationship among social support, postpartum depression and quality of life of puerperal women. Methods A total of 348 puerperal women were investigated with Postnatal Social Support Questionnaire,Edinburgh Postnatal Depression Scale (EPDS) and WHO Quality of Life-BREF (WHOQOL-BREF). Results Pearson correlation analysis showed that there was a significant positive correlation between social support and the quality of life (r=0.483, P < 0.01), and a significant negative correlation to postpartum depression (r=-0.243, P < 0.01),and a significant negative correlation between postpartum depression and quality of life (r=-0.408, P<0.01). Intermediary effect of postpartum depression was tested. Conclusions A good social support system is benefit to improve depression scores for EPDS, and promote the life quality in puerperal women.
		                        		
		                        		
		                        		
		                        	
8.Penicillin-binding proteins genotyping of penicillin resistance Streptococcus pneumonia isolated from children in Guangzhou area
Yanmei HUANG ; Xiaomin LIN ; Jialiang MAI ; Bingshao LIANG ; Yongqiang XIE ; Huamin ZHONG ; Qiulian DENG ; Zhenwen ZHOU
International Journal of Laboratory Medicine 2017;38(7):873-875,879
		                        		
		                        			
		                        			Objective To understand the molecular epidemiology of penicillin resistance Streptococcus pneumonia (PNSP) isolated from children in Guangzhou area to provide the experimental basis for clinical prevention and control of Streptococcus pneumonia infectious diseases.Methods Specific primers were designed according to Genebank,penicillin binding protein(PBP) genes PBP1A,PBP1B,PBP2A,PBP2B,PBP2X,PBP3 were amplified by PCR.The sequencing analysis was performed.The PCR products were digested by Hinf I,and the restriction fragment length polymorphism (RFLP) was analyzed.Results DNA of PNSP was successfully extracted,the PCR results showed that in 50 strains of PNSP,the positive rates of bacterial strains containing PBP1A,PBP1B,PBP2A,PBP2B,PBP2X and PBP3 were 48.9%,64.4%,71.1%,31.1%,40.0% and 31.1% respectively.The sequencing showed that their homologies with known sequences in GenBank were 99%,98%,100%,97%,95% and 100% respectively.Using RFLP in Hinf I showed that PBP1A,PBP1B,PBP2A and PBP3 only had one kind of genotype,PBP2B and PBP2X had two kinds of genotypes,the positive rates were 71.4%,28.6%,66.7% and 33.3% respectively.Conclusion The gene distribution of PNSP strains among children in Guangzhou is dominated by PBP2A,PBP1B and PBP1A,there are two subtypes in PBP2B,PBP2X when digested by Hinf I,in which the predominant subtype >65%.
		                        		
		                        		
		                        		
		                        	
9.Clone and expression of APH(3′′)-Ⅰand AAC(2′)-Ⅰ gene of Stenotrophomonas maltophilia
Xiaoshan GUAN ; Ruili GUAN ; Huamin ZHONG ; Qiulian DENG ; Yongqiang XIE ; Zhenwen ZHOU
International Journal of Laboratory Medicine 2016;37(15):2099-2101
		                        		
		                        			
		                        			Objective To perform the amplification ,sequencing and prokaryotic expression of APH (3′′)‐Ⅰ and AAC (2′)‐Ⅰgenes from the clinically isolated gzch810 strain(SM gzch810)of Stenotrophomonas maltophilia to provide the basic materials for the next step functional test .Methods The SM gzch810 genome chromosome was extracted ,the APH (3′′)‐Ⅰ ,AAC (2′)‐Ⅰ whole genes were amplified by PCR and sequenced after being cloned into pMD18‐T vector .The recombination were subcloned into pGEX‐4T‐1 vector and the expression of the recombinant APH (3′′)‐Ⅰ and AAC (2′)‐Ⅰ were analyzed by SDS‐PAGE .Results The 800bp and 550bp DNA fragments of APH(3′′)‐Ⅰ ,AAC(2′)‐Ⅰ gene were amplified from SM gzch810 by PCR and sequenced ;the sequence comparison analysis showed that DNA and amino acid sequence identities of APH (3′′)‐Ⅰand AAC (2′)‐Ⅰ genes with other strains were 91% and 95% respectively .The sequence of APH (3′′)‐Ⅰand AAC(2′)‐Ⅰ of SM gzch810 were submitted to GenBank(accession number :HQ315852 and HQ315853);two major protein bands corresponding to the expected recombinant GST‐TP fusion proteins (56 × 103 and 46 × 103 respectively) were identified by SDS‐PAGE .Conclusion APH(3′′)‐Ⅰand AAC(2′)‐Ⅰgene of SM gzch810 are successfully cloned and expressed ,which lays a good foundation for further detecting corresponding antibi‐otic resistance and functional evaluation of above two kinds of recombinant E .coli .
		                        		
		                        		
		                        		
		                        	
10.Investigation of posttraumatic stress disorders after accidents in Pearl River Delta *
Lei SHI ; Kexiong ZHOU ; Fangmei YANG ; Xishun ZHANG ; Liguang CHEN ; Qiu GUO ; Qiulian CHEN ; Shu XING ; Yi SONG
Chongqing Medicine 2013;(21):2511-2513
		                        		
		                        			
		                        			Objective To investigate the incidence and related risk factors of post-traumatic stress disorders (PTSD) after acci-dents in the Pearl River Delta .Methods Inpatients after accidents from April 2009 to February 2010 in seven hospitals of the Pearl River Delta cities ,such as Guangzhou ,Shenzhen and Zhuhai ,were surveyed with PTSD Checklist-Civilian Version (PCL-C) and self-made questionnaire .Results In a total of 554 post traumatic patients ,a prevalence of 28 .5% of PTSD symptoms were found in this region with 7 .8% (marks≥50) of severe degree and 20 .8% (marks :38-49) of mild to moderate degree .In the severe PTSD symptoms group ,the top three items were getting nervous and upset once faced similar situation ,difficulty sleeping or easy to be a-wake ,and the trauma experience caused recurring disturbing memory ,ideas or image .Multivariate analysis showed that female ,una-ble self-care ,incapable of working ,lack help from friends ,multiple injury ,and injury time longer were all associated with the PTSD symptom incidence .Conclusion The prevalence of PTSD symptoms is relatively high in injured patients after accidents in the Pearl River Delta .Early identification and intervention of PTSD symptoms in post-traumatic patients are important for the prevention of PTSD .
